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 11/03/2013, à 19:26

arketip

[resolu] crontab @reboot

Bonjour,

J'ai un soucis pour programmer cron au démarrage de l'ordinateur.
Il semble que le raccourci @reboot soit sans effet (du moins comme je l'utilise), contrairement à la programmation à horaire fixe qui fonctionne très bien.

Si j'ajoute ces 2 lignes avec crontab -e:

@reboot echo "crontab reboot" >/home/arketip/crontabreboot
*/3 * * * * echo "crontab 3 min" >/home/arketip/crontab3min

La programmation toutes les 3 minutes fonctionne très bien et me crée donc un fichier texte après 3 minutes...
Celle qui contient le raccourci @reboot (utilisant la même commande) ne fait rien, nada.

Auriez-vous une idée de ce qui se passe ?
Merci.

++

NOTE: j'ai essayé avec le raccourci @hourly et tout fonctionne correctement dans ce cas.
Ce n'est donc pas une erreur liée aux raccourcis comme je l'ai cru initialement.

Dernière modification par arketip (Le 11/03/2013, à 23:36)

Hors ligne

#2 Le 11/03/2013, à 21:37

ljere

Re : [resolu] crontab @reboot

il me semble que pour fonctionner tu dois l'utiliser de cette façon

@reboot ton_utilisateur ta commande

ancien PC Toshiba satellite_c670d-11 / Linux Mint 21 Vanessa
Nouveau PC ASUS TUF GAMING A17 GPU RTX 4070 CPU AMD Ryzen 9 7940HS w/ Radeon 780M Graphics / Linux Mint 21.2 Victoria / Kernel: 6.4.8-1-liquorix / Desktop: Cinnamon

Hors ligne

#3 Le 11/03/2013, à 21:42

tiramiseb

Re : [resolu] crontab @reboot

ljere: non, la mention de l'utilisateur dépend surtout de la façon dont la crontab est configurée, et n'a pas de lien avec la notation du moment où exécuter le truc.

Le nom d'utilisateur ne doit être mis que pour les crontab système, dans /etc/cron.d ou dans /etc/crontab.

Hors ligne

#4 Le 11/03/2013, à 21:46

ljere

Re : [resolu] crontab @reboot

il me semblait que dans le cas de @reboot il fallait l'indiquer, sinon je ne vois pas d'autre raison que ça ne fonctionne pas


ancien PC Toshiba satellite_c670d-11 / Linux Mint 21 Vanessa
Nouveau PC ASUS TUF GAMING A17 GPU RTX 4070 CPU AMD Ryzen 9 7940HS w/ Radeon 780M Graphics / Linux Mint 21.2 Victoria / Kernel: 6.4.8-1-liquorix / Desktop: Cinnamon

Hors ligne

#5 Le 11/03/2013, à 21:52

tiramiseb

Re : [resolu] crontab @reboot

arketip,

Ton "home" est-il chiffré ? Si oui, cron n'y a pas accès au démarrage de l'ordinateur...

Hors ligne

#6 Le 11/03/2013, à 23:28

arketip

Re : [resolu] crontab @reboot

Ha oui, j'ai coché le chiffrement lors de l’installation.
C'était donc ça. Je vais donc modifier le chemin et je vous tiens au courant.
++

Hors ligne

#7 Le 11/03/2013, à 23:35

arketip

Re : [resolu] crontab @reboot

Bien vu tiramiseb, c'était bien le chiffrement.
En prenant un autre chemin comme /tmp tout fonctionne nickel.

Merci à tous pour vous être pris les méninges sur ce problème.

++

Hors ligne